I know that my “Life Begins at Rape” meme didn’t go anywhere, but I’m not giving up. I’m going to keep trying. Sooner or later, I’m bound to come up with a breakthrough meme. Here’s my most recent attempt… Let’s see what happens. And, speaking of Elizabeth Warren, did you hear the news? It looks […]
Connect









